Variation of the number of first spermatocytes in relation to fertility in Drosophila virilis

Abstract
The number of first spermatocytes per cyst in 5 iso-female strains of Drosophila virilis was studied with regard to fertility. The cysts involving 8cells were dominantly seen in TK and B33, and 9cells in A12 and A13 strains. But B12 strain had a highest mode of 12cells. Meioses could be assumed to proceed in every strain. The analysis of variance for the number of spermatids per bundle showed great difference between B12 and any other strain. The male fertility was also significantly different between TK and B12. The mean progeny numbers per male were 2300.1 in TK and 243.1 in B12, respectively. No significant difference was detected in female fertility.
